Rated 2 out of 5 stars

Dreadful returns process and product didn’t work for me

Product not all its cracked up to be and returns performance is extremely poor.
I bought a pest off bird feeder 3 as my existing feeder failed to cope with Jackdaws. I placed it exactly where the other feeder was and filled it with a premium bird seed mix. Maybe my regular garden birds are especially sensitive but they wouldn’t go near this feeder. I removed all other feeders which are emptied daily, but still no joy within 7 days, so I gave up and decided to return it.
That wasn’t as easy as it should be. I buy a lot online and most companies make returns simple, easy and most importantly keep you fully informed throughout the process. Don’t expect any of that from these guys.
1. You have to request the return and await their agreement.
2. Then you have to prepay their courier for a collection and wait in on the day selected for them to call. Except they don’t! No contact and no collection for 3 days.
3. Then they tell you if this happens (probably a lot) to contact the courier and rearrange the collection, and yet again they fail to turn up or contact you.
4. At this point your only option is to arrange you own return with someone reputable like Royal Mail.
5. First though you have to request a refund for the extra charge for the failed courier collection. This was actioned promptly.
6. Once you have proof of delivery don’t expect any acknowledgement of receipt of your return, they don’t bother with this. so you have to send them a copy of the POD.
7. Following this they still failed to send any acknowledgement of receipt of the return.
8. Eventually having heard nothing after 2 weeks I lost patience and raised it with Paypal and only then did notification of the refund arrive, 15 days after the goods were delivered back to them.
I can’t recommend the product as the birds in my garden just didn’t like it. I bought a Squirrel Buster seed feeder and this is working extremely well.
I can’t recommend the company as they seem to be extremely focussed on marketing, yet neglect basic professional customer service regarding returns.

We're sorry to hear about the damage to your feeder.

When you contacted us, our team reviewed the situation and identified that the feeder had not been hung in accordance with the instructions, specifically that it was too close to a vertical surface the squirrel was able to use as a platform. This is important because when a squirrel can brace itself against a nearby branch, fence, wall or pole, it can apply sustained pressure to the feeder without triggering the weight-activated mechanism, which allows it to gnaw at the plastic over time. When hung correctly with at least 45cm of clearance in all directions, squirrels cannot maintain the stability needed to do this, a lot of effort for very little reward means they quickly give up and move on.

We want to be clear that we were not being dismissive, we were providing an honest explanation of why the damage occurred and how to prevent it happening again. This is not something we see when feeders are correctly positioned.

As the damage was a result of the hanging position rather than a product fault, we were not in a position to offer a free replacement. However we did offer the replacement top and tube components at a reduced price as a goodwill gesture to help get the feeder back into use as cost effectively as possible.

We're sorry to hear you've been having issues with one side of the feeder mechanism. We'd genuinely like to help resolve this.

We'd like to address your point about our customer service. When you first contacted us, asking for a photo of the hanging position is standard practice as it is the most common cause of mechanism issues, we ask every customer this regardless of whether squirrels have been mentioned, as positioning affects how the ports open and close. We're sorry if the squirrel reference in our response felt irrelevant to your situation, it was part of our standard guidance rather than an assumption about your specific garden.

Having read your review, we believe we may have identified what is causing the mechanism to jam. You mention using suet pellets, and we are currently experiencing very hot weather. High temperatures cause the natural fats and oils in suet pellets and dried mealworms to sweat and melt, creating a sticky residue inside the feeder tube that causes feed to clump together and block the mechanism. This affects every feeder on the market in hot conditions, not just ours.

There are a few simple steps that will resolve this, mixing the pellets with sunflower hearts so the dry seed absorbs surface oils and keeps the feed separated, moving the feeder into a shaded spot away from direct sunlight, and only putting out small portions at a time so the feed doesn't sit in the heat long enough to clump. This is almost certainly what you're experiencing and it's a quick fix.
